Fleur Capital Corporation is seeking Federal Reserve approval to become a bank holding company by acquiring Simmesport State Bank in Louisiana. The notice opens a public comment period. Businesses, customers, competitors, and community members can submit written comments on the application by July 15, 2026, but should avoid including confidential information because comments are generally made public.
